Nos últimos dez anos, muitas aplicações transferiram algumas ou todas as suas capacidades e serviços para a nuvem, e o mesmo acontece com o software de design de PCB. Plataformas de design de PCB na nuvem podem ser muito convenientes para hobbistas ou estudantes que não trabalham em produtos complexos. Portanto, não é surpresa que novos designers tendam a gravitar em torno dessas ferramentas para ganhar experiência de design inicial.
À medida que os designs se tornam mais complexos, a nuvem oferece apenas um conjunto limitado de capacidades que realmente importam para o design de PCB. Isso acontece porque designs complexos rapidamente se tornam intensivos em computação, e isso significa que algumas atividades precisam ser realizadas no seu desktop. É por isso que pensamos que uma abordagem híbrida de nuvem+desktop é a melhor opção para designers que desejam capacidades de colaboração e compartilhamento na nuvem. Vamos examinar algumas dessas opções neste artigo.
Softwares de design de PCB na nuvem podem ser divididos em duas categorias: nativos da nuvem e híbridos com uma aplicação de desktop. Existem ofertas gratuitas de design de PCB na nuvem em ambas as categorias. Primeiro, vamos dar uma olhada nas opções de software de design de PCB totalmente online.
A ferramenta Upverter começou como uma ferramenta totalmente baseada em navegador para captura esquemática e layout de PCB. Ela também inclui recursos de compartilhamento, que permitem aos usuários tornar seus projetos publicamente disponíveis para uso gratuito. O Upverter também possibilita a criação de componentes e a exportação de arquivos de fabricação para o desktop do usuário. Foi uma das primeiras plataformas de software de design de PCB na nuvem disponíveis comercialmente, mais tarde expandida para incluir um nível pro com acesso a simulação e recursos de design colaborativo de PCB.

Visualização no navegador web do Editor de Circuitos Clássico do Upverter
Hoje, o editor de circuitos clássico e a ferramenta de layout de PCB ainda estão disponíveis, mas há uma nova oferta na plataforma Upverter: Upverter Modular (anteriormente conhecido como Geppetto). A plataforma Upverter Modular é uma plataforma de arrastar e soltar para projetar computadores de placa única a partir de módulos de hardware predefinidos. As opções de COM/SOM suportadas incluem Raspberry Pi CM4 e outros.

Enquanto a ferramenta de design Upverter legada é para hobbistas e estudantes, a ferramenta Upverter Modular oferece hardware de grau profissional sem exigir conhecimento aprofundado de design de PCB.
EasyEDA é uma plataforma de design de PCB na nuvem desenvolvida e pertencente à LCSC, um distribuidor chinês de componentes eletrônicos. A interface online contém modelos de componentes para pacotes comuns disponíveis através do catálogo da LCSC. Os usuários têm acesso a um editor de esquemáticos básico e uma ferramenta de layout de PCB, podendo exportar e baixar seus arquivos de fabricação após completarem o design.
Como a maioria das outras plataformas de design elétrico ou mecânico baseadas na nuvem, o EasyEDA não é adequado para designs complexos de alta contagem de camadas. Por exemplo:
Isso elimina seu uso como uma ferramenta de design para uma enorme gama de produtos comerciais. Além disso, a restrição ao uso exclusivo de números de peça da LCSC não está alinhada com as práticas básicas de cadeia de suprimentos e aquisição de cada negócio de eletrônicos profissional no planeta.

Visualização 3D de um PCB simples no EasyEDA [Fonte: easyeda.com]
Como uma plataforma em nuvem mais recente, Flux.ai combina muitas das funcionalidades encontradas no Upverter e EasyEDA com um copiloto de IA integrado. O copiloto pode realizar tarefas simples no esquemático e responder a perguntas técnicas quando necessário. A plataforma foca principalmente na reutilização de design, com a capacidade de reutilizar projetos e circuitos de código aberto, similar ao Upverter. Algumas partes do layout da PCB são automatizadas de uma maneira única, onde regras são definidas pelo usuário e usadas para preencher certas características de cobre.

Vista do layout da PCB no Flux.ai [Fonte: flux.ai]
Apesar da plataforma ser mais recente, e embora forneça dados da cadeia de suprimentos de múltiplos distribuidores, a plataforma contém os mesmos problemas de escalabilidade que o EasyEDA. Atualmente, ela só pode suportar PCBs rígidas e torna-se extremamente lenta com um alto número de camadas. Enquanto a funcionalidade de IA é inovadora, até 2026 sua capacidade é insignificante em comparação com outras ferramentas centradas em IA que geram esquemáticos de referência.
|
Categoria de Funcionalidade |
Editor de Circuito Clássico do Upverter |
EasyEDA |
Flux.ai |
|
Captura esquemática baseada em navegador |
X |
X |
X |
|
Layout de PCB baseado em navegador |
X |
X |
X |
|
Esquemáticos multi-folhas, hierárquicos |
X |
||
|
Regras de design / DRC |
X |
X |
X |
|
Roteamento de pares diferenciais |
X |
||
|
Visualização 3D da PCB |
X |
X |
|
|
Ferramentas integradas de BOM |
X |
X |
X |
|
Bibliotecas de componentes integradas |
X |
X |
X |
|
Links de fabricantes/distribuidores (disponibilidade de peças) |
X |
X |
|
|
Saídas CAM (Gerber + Furação NC) |
X |
X |
X |
|
Controle de versão / histórico de design |
X |
||
|
Colaboração em tempo real (edição multiusuário) |
X |
||
|
Link para compartilhamento para visualização/comentários |
X |
X |
X |
|
Simulação SPICE |
X |
||
|
Integração direta com a fabricação |
X |
||
|
Controles de acesso / permissões empresariais |
X |
Quando o desempenho da aplicação até contagens altas de peças, redes e camadas é crítico, uma parte das funcionalidades de design precisa ser movida para o desktop. É aqui que o design de PCB híbrido nuvem+desktop entra em jogo. Essas plataformas deixam as funcionalidades intensivas em computação rodando no desktop para garantir o desempenho da aplicação com tempo de resposta rápido. Enquanto isso, as funcionalidades de gestão de dados e colaboração estão disponíveis através de uma plataforma de nuvem dedicada.
Atualmente, existem três plataformas híbridas nuvem+desktop, e apenas duas dessas plataformas são dedicadas puramente ao design e fabricação de PCB. São elas CircuitMaker e Altium Designer, com as funcionalidades de colaboração na nuvem e gestão de dados rodando no Altium 365.
Autodesk Fusion (anteriormente Fusion 360) é principalmente uma plataforma CAD mecânica, integrando CAD, CAM e CAE para otimizar o fluxo de trabalho de design para fabricação de peças mecânicas. Sua arquitetura nativa na nuvem facilita a colaboração e garante que os dados do projeto estejam acessíveis de qualquer lugar, tornando-o uma escolha forte para startups e PMEs focadas em design de produto e modelagem 3D.
Embora o Fusion inclua ferramentas de design de PCB, elas são em grande parte derivadas de um produto mais antigo (Autodesk EAGLE) e não operam no mesmo calibre que outras plataformas de software de design de PCB na nuvem. Apesar da capacidade de visualizar modelos 3D da caixa e do PCB, a plataforma carece de recursos básicos de design de PCB, como gerenciamento de biblioteca, o que praticamente eliminou seu uso por engenheiros eletrônicos profissionais.

Visualização do layout de PCB no Autodesk Fusion [Fonte: autodesk.com]
CircuitMaker foi projetado como uma ferramenta gratuita para makers, hobbistas, estudantes e engenheiros em tempo parcial. O CircuitMaker é executado no seu desktop e inclui todas as características básicas que você encontraria em outros softwares gratuitos de design de PCB, como o KiCad. Além de executar as ferramentas de design básicas no seu desktop para garantir uma experiência suave e uma resposta rápida, os usuários podem armazenar seus projetos em um espaço de trabalho pessoal no Altium 365. Armazenar projetos na nuvem torna o compartilhamento extremamente fácil, permitindo que colaboradores visualizem e acessem seus designs em uma interface web ou dentro do CircuitMaker.

O CircuitMaker foi destinado ao uso por estudantes e hobbistas, e seu ponto de preço gratuito o torna uma opção atraente para esse grupo de designers. O CircuitMaker inclui muitas das mesmas características do Altium Designer, com o mesmo fluxo de trabalho, atalhos de teclado e modos de operação. Isso significa que os usuários do CircuitMaker estão essencialmente obtendo prática gratuita em como usar as ferramentas mais avançadas no Altium Designer.
Finalmente, o CircuitMaker também oferece uma capacidade única não encontrada em programas como EasyEDA ou KiCad. Há um conector disponível para transferir seu design para o Autodesk Fusion para colaboração MCAD. Isso permite aos usuários projetar invólucros mecânicos, posicionar componentes chave, projetar interfaces de montagem ou fixação, e muito mais.

A principal plataforma híbrida de design de PCB que combina nuvem e desktop é o Altium Designer e o Altium 365, disponíveis juntos como a plataforma Altium Develop. O Altium Designer é executado no desktop do usuário e oferece as principais funcionalidades de posicionamento, roteamento e captura esquemática necessárias para criar um PCB. Na nuvem, o Altium 365 gerencia os dados com controle de versão integrado, funcionalidades de gerenciamento de bibliotecas, uma ferramenta de sourcing abrangente para BOMs e muito mais.

Com o Altium 365 agora sendo padrão no pacote Altium Develop, os recursos disponíveis na nuvem trazem um novo conjunto de funcionalidades para os designers, mesmo que você não utilize a nuvem para colaboração. Por exemplo, o gerenciamento de bibliotecas e a precificação de BOM são duas áreas nas quais os usuários podem ser mais eficientes e eficazes ao completar a documentação do projeto e garantir dados consistentes de componentes entre projetos.
Comparação de Software de Design de PCB Nuvem+Desktop
|
Categoria de Recurso |
Autodesk Fusion |
CircuitMaker |
Altium Designer |
|
Captura esquemática hierárquica e multi-folhas |
X |
X |
X |
|
Layout de PCB com visualização 3D + verificação de folga |
X |
X |
X |
|
Roteamento interativo, ajuste interativo, autorroteamento |
X |
X |
X |
|
Roteamento de pares diferenciais |
X |
X |
X |
|
Regras de design / DRC |
X |
X |
X |
|
Saídas CAM (Gerber + Furação NC, ODB++) |
X |
X |
X |
|
Fluxo de trabalho de saída estilo “Release” |
X |
X |
|
|
Saídas SmartPDF |
X |
X |
|
|
Biblioteca de componentes suportada por dados do Octopart |
X |
X |
|
|
Projetos hospedados na nuvem (Altium 365) |
X |
X |
X |
|
Compartilhar projetos para visualização/comentários |
X |
X |
X |
|
Encontrar componentes de PCB fornecidos por fabricantes de peças |
X |
||
|
Simulação SPICE no editor esquemático |
X |
X |
|
|
Criação automática de desenhos |
X |
||
|
Recursos de design de PCB HDI |
X |
||
|
Design de PCB rígido-flexível |
X |
||
|
Design de sistema multi-placa |
X |
A maioria das plataformas de design de PCB na nuvem só são úteis para projetos mais simples devido à largura de banda necessária para executar um ambiente de design de PCB adequado. A exceção é o Upverter Modular, que é uma interface de arrastar e soltar que não utiliza um ambiente padrão de layout e roteamento de PCB, portanto, não requer recursos de computação.
É por isso que existe a abordagem nuvem+híbrida para designs mais avançados: as partes que exigem muitos recursos de computação são feitas no desktop, enquanto a colaboração e o gerenciamento de dados acontecem através da nuvem. Pense nisso como adicionar o Google Drive ao seu sistema de design de PCB, mas com um link de acesso integrado diretamente ao seu software de design de PCB.
Portanto, se você sabe que trabalhará com design avançado e precisa da nuvem para colaboração e compartilhamento, a melhor aposta é uma plataforma híbrida nuvem+desktop como CircuitMaker ou Altium Develop.
Se você quer avançar na sua carreira como designer, então deve começar a aprender e usar o Altium Designer. Seja para construir eletrônicos de potência confiáveis ou sistemas digitais avançados, entre em contato com um especialista na Altium para começar!
Se você não pode justificar o custo de uma licença do Altium Designer, a melhor opção é o CircuitMaker. É uma ferramenta gratuita de esquemático + layout de PCB construída sobre a tecnologia central do Altium Designer, com colaboração online e armazenamento de projetos através de um Espaço Pessoal no Altium 365. As funcionalidades do CircuitMaker funcionam muito da mesma forma que as ferramentas do Altium Designer, o que dará aos usuários uma vantagem de habilidades e experiência quando começarem a procurar um emprego em engenharia elétrica.
Upverter Modular utiliza uma abordagem de arrastar e soltar para o design de PCBs, onde os usuários adicionam módulos prontos para uso em um novo design. Os usuários então precisam especificar as conexões que desejam entre os módulos, e a ferramenta preenche o restante das informações. É uma ótima opção para estudantes e usuários não técnicos, pois eles não precisam ter treinamento em design de PCB para produzir um produto funcional.
Não. Os usuários do CircuitMaker podem acessar um espaço de trabalho pessoal com armazenamento limitado para seus projetos de design. Para acessar o armazenamento do espaço de trabalho, baixe e instale o CircuitMaker e, em seguida, crie uma conta Altium quando executar o software pela primeira vez.
Plataformas na nuvem processam tudo em servidores remotos, então designs mais complexos requerem mais capacidade de processamento e largura de banda de rede ao usar a ferramenta de design. Isso cria um atraso perceptível durante o design. É por isso que o modelo híbrido nuvem+desktop foi introduzido; as tarefas que requerem baixa latência são feitas no desktop e as tarefas são realizadas na nuvem.
Sim. O CircuitMaker e o Altium Designer compartilham o mesmo formato de arquivo, então você pode abrir projetos do CircuitMaker diretamente no Altium Designer sem precisar recriar seu trabalho. Isso torna o CircuitMaker uma excelente plataforma para aprender gratuitamente, e depois os usuários podem fazer upgrade quando precisarem de recursos avançados.
Tipicamente, não. As principais ferramentas de design rodam no seu computador local, não na nuvem, então tarefas básicas de design não requerem uma conexão com a internet. No entanto, acessar arquivos de design, salvá-los no seu repositório e certas outras funcionalidades exigirão uma conexão com a internet.